How ketamine aids melancholy
Ketamine for melancholy received its begin in Belgium inside the sixties being an anesthesia medicine for animals. The FDA approved it being an anesthetic for men and women in 1970. It was used in dealing with injured soldiers around the battlefields during the Vietnam War. Unexpected emergency responders may give it to an agitated client who, by way of example, ketamine for depression have rescued from a suicide try. That’s how Ken Stewart, MD, says Medical practitioners began to recognize that the ketamine drug experienced potent outcomes from depression and suicidal ideas.
“Someone is trying to jump off a bridge and they provide him ketamine during the ambulance to relaxed him down and 9 months later, he states, ‘I haven’t felt suicidal for 9 months.’

Obtaining Ketamine For Despair
Ketamine for depression is available in several varieties. The only one that the FDA has authorised being a medication for despair is actually a nasal spray termed esketamine (Spravato). It’s for Grownups who both haven’t been served by antidepressant capsules, have main depressive ailment, or are suicidal. They carry on on their antidepressant and obtain esketamine at a doctor’s Business or in a clinic, the place a health treatment service provider watches over them for two hrs after the dose.
For therapy-resistant despair, people ordinarily receive the nasal spray twice a week for one to four weeks; then as soon as each week for weeks five to nine; after which you can the moment every single 7 days or 2 after that. The spray features a “black box” warning about the chance of sedation and difficulties with focus, judgment, and thinking, together with threat for abuse or misuse of the drug and suicidal ideas and behaviors.
Other sorts of ketamine for despair not accepted via the FDA for psychological wellness disorders consist of IV infusion, a shot while in the arm, or lozenges. Most investigate appears at ketamine presented by IV. You could only get it by IV or shot in a health care provider’s office. Some Medical professionals will prescribe lozenges for at-household use — generally to help keep despair at bay concerning infusions.

Ketamine or ect
Ketamine is normally thought of safe, including for people who are experiencing suicidal ideation (views or strategies for suicide). The principle Uncomfortable side effects are dissociation, intoxication, sedation, significant blood pressure, dizziness, headache, blurred eyesight, anxiousness, nausea, and vomiting. Ketamine is averted or utilized with Extraordinary caution in the next teams:
• those with a background of psychosis or schizophrenia, click here as there is concern the dissociation ketamine provides could make psychotic Conditions even worse
• those with a history of substance use problem, simply because ketamine could potentially cause euphoria (most likely by triggering the opioid receptors) and a number of people may become addicted to it (which is named ketamine use problem)
• teenagers, as there are numerous fears about the long-time period outcomes of ketamine within the continue to-developing adolescent Mind
• people who are Expecting or breastfeeding

Other brain outcomes of ketamine for depression
Ketamine may match in other techniques during the Mind, way too. Some nerve cells (neurons) while in the brain associated with temper make use of a chemical (neurotransmitter) known as glutamate to talk to one another. The nerve cells require glutamate receptors think of them like catcher’s mitts for glutamate in an effort to be a part of With this conversation.
During the brains of some people with melancholy, People nerve cells don’t get so energized by glutamate anymore. It’s as When the glutamate receptors the catcher’s mitts are deactivated or weakened.
But after those with this particular difficulty obtain ketamine, Those people nerve mobile connections get restocked with new glutamate receptors. It’s as though ketamine assists make new catcher’s mitts for the glutamate, so that the nerve cells can reply to it again.
